Two-Month Fundraising Period for 2009 Elections Ends

Candidates to file campaign finance disclosures with CFB on Friday, May 15
May 12, 2009

Yesterday was the final day of the eighth reporting period for the 2009 citywide elections. All candidates, including those who do not choose to take part in the Campaign Finance Program, will file required disclosure statements of their campaigns’ financial activity from March 12 through May 11, 2009 on Friday, May 15.

With four months left before the 2009 primary elections, there are 264 active candidates registered with the Campaign Finance Board. Since the March 16 filing date, 54 candidates have registered with the CFB for the 2009 citywide elections. A complete list of 2009 candidates is available here. This list reflects the number of candidates registered with the CFB as of today.

FILING DAY DETAILS

Candidates may deliver statements to the CFB by hand, submit their filings electronically, or send the materials by mail (as long as mailed submissions are postmarked by May 15).

As disclosures are filed on May 15, the CFB will update its website with the latest financial information frequently during the day. A press advisory will be issued to alert interested parties each time that new information is posted to the website.

CERTIFICATION DEADLINE

The last day for candidates to join the Campaign Finance Program is June 10, 2009. 38 candidates have already certified. June 10 is also the deadline for candidates to submit their information to be printed in the 2009 Voter Guide.
